Ukulele BASS?????
AreaQNH870 1 year ago 3
@AreaQNH870
Ayup.
A buddy and I were lucky to attend one of their concerts last month.
Needless to say the Ukes rocked!!!
That buddy has been playing bass guitar for nearly 30 years and I trust his judgement,
when he said it was defintely a ukulele bass.
We took a closer look at the instrument during the break between the 2 sets.
The soundbox was smaller and the scale length shorter than what you get with a normal acoustic bass.
